How Our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Process Works
When you call us, we’ll send a team of experts to your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an for repair. Our process is designed to be efficient and effective, with a focus on getting your crawl space back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ll start by containing the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ure your safety.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the problem.
Step 2: Water Removal
Next, we’ll remove any standing water from your crawl space using powerful pumps and vacuums.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
With the water remov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your crawl space.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your crawl space is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Once your crawl space is dry, we’ll repair any damaged insulation, drywall, or other materials. Our technicians will work with you to ensure that your crawl space is restored to its original condition.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Finally,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ection of your crawl space to ensure that it’s safe and healthy. We’ll also clean up any debris and leave your property looking like new.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Laurel, FL
The cost of crawl space water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Laurel, FL.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the specific needs of your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$200 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the containment process. |
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,000 | The amount of water present and the difficulty of removal.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the difficulty of drying. |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required. |

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Damage Repair
Q: What causes crawl space water damage?
A: Crawl space water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, and poor ventilation.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a customized solution.
Q: How long does crawl space water damage repair take?
A: The length of time it takes to repair crawl space water damage depends on the severity of the damage and the complexity of the repair process.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an and ensure that the repairs are completed as quickly as possible.
Q: Is crawl space water damage covered by insurance?
A: Yes, crawl space water damage may be covered by your insurance policy. Our team can help you navigate the claims process and 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.
Q: Can I prevent crawl space water damage?
A: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ent crawl space water damage, including regular inspections, proper ventilation, and prompt repair of any leaks or damage. Our team can provide you with customized recommendations to help you protect your property.
